Cowen is the Bram Stoker Award Nominated of author of Bleeding Saffron (Weasel Press 2018) and three other books of poetry, Sixth and Adams (PW Press 2001), The Madness of Empty Spaces (Weasel Press 2014) and The Seven Yards of Sorrow (Weasel Press 2016), and Bleeding Saffron (Weasel Press 2018). Madness and Seven Yards were also short-listed for the Bram Stoker Award in their respective years of publication. David has published poetry, fiction and non-fiction in journals in the United States, Great Britain and Australia. David was also the editor of the Amazon Kindle Best Selling Horror Writer Association’s Poetry Showcase Volumes III and IV. David's Essay Hope Dished Out in Plenty was featured by Thisibelieve.org in a Thanksgiving feature in 2008. The Canadian Radio Company's Outfront series included a poem by David in their 9/11 tribute. David is currently editor of the HWA Poetry Blog.

David is a past juried poet of the Houston Poetry Fest, Austin Poetry Festival and Waco Wordfest and has been given awards in multiple poetry competitions. David is a practicing attorney originally from Brownsville, Texas and who now resides in Houston, Texas.
